An opening has arisen for a Housing Officer in South Derbyshire. Said individual will be the main point of contact for tenants in a geographical area, managing rent accounts, tenancy and estate issues, tenant welfare and support.
The successful candidate will be responsible for:
- Act on reports of Anti-Social Behaviour, following the agreed procedure.
- Support ASB complainants throughout the processing of their complaint.
- Record ASB, open and record cases on Orchard using the Community Action Solutions (CAS) management system.
- Issuing of Community Protection Warnings, Community Protection Notices, Notice of Seeking Possession (Tenancy Agreement breaches).
- Production of Housing Management and Witness Statements
- Effective monitoring and recovery of arrears of rent, following the agreed procedure, by carrying out interviews with tenants in the home and in the Council’s offices, sending correspondence by phone, letter, email and text messages
- Work with other organisations and departments, such as Housing Benefit and support agencies, to resolve outstanding arrears cases
- Prepare and serve such as Notices of Intention to Seek Possession.
- Prepare details for the listing of tenants in possession hearings at the County Court
- Attend Court Hearings in the absence of the Senior Housing Officer
